No se trata de lo que quieres comprar, sino de quién quieres ser. Aprovecha el precio especial.

Antes: $249

Currency
$209

Paga en 4 cuotas sin intereses

Paga en 4 cuotas sin intereses
Suscríbete

Termina en:

13 Días
1 Hrs
51 Min
17 Seg

Conoce .NET 6

3/26

Lectura

En la clase anterior acabamos de instalar Visual Studio Community 2019. Sin embargo, Microsoft recientemente lanzó la versión 2022, pero… ¿qué cambia exactamente? ¿Me impedirá seguir el curso? ¿Debo instalar otra versión? 🤔… Bien, comparemos estas versiones 😉. Spoiler: Esto no te impedirá continuar con el curso, pero te enseñaré a trabajar con esta versión 👀.

...

Regístrate o inicia sesión para leer el resto del contenido.

Aportes 22

Preguntas 4

Ordenar por:

¿Quieres ver más aportes, preguntas y respuestas de la comunidad?

Pequeño resumen acerca de las versiones de .NET:

  • .NET Framework (4.8) = Apicaciones solo para Windows
  • .NET Core (3.1) = Version OpenSource que es multiplataforma.
  • .NET 5 (y luego la 6) = Version más reciente que unifica .Net Core con .NET Framework, opensource y multiplataforma

¡Qué tal rollo lo de las versiones de .NET!
Recomiendo este video, muy bueno: https://www.youtube.com/watch?v=zWfIl2Za-es

Algo me dice que es el mejor momento para aprender c#

Si trabajan con VS 2019 es bueno no instalar aún VS 2022, porque al menos yo, tuve un gran problema de compatibilidad con los proyectos en los que trabajo.

Considero que, si queremos usar lo último de las características que nos ofrece Visual Studio, es mejor instalar Vs. 2022 y el .net 6. Pero si queremos tener estabilidad y un soporte continuo, es mejor instalar .net framework 3.1, el cual es una versión LTS que brinda todavía un soporte largo en el tiempo

Hizo fata una explicación sobre generalidades de los nombres de las versiones de .NET y sus capacidades.

Aun no me quedó claro si se debe instalar o no la versión más reciente. Según los comentarios, algunos dicen que sí, otros que no. La verdad creo que esto debe de dejarse claro desde la clase anterior.

El profesor Celis me parece buena onda :v

Muy clara la explicacion.

Esta clase, me ayudo bastante, gracias Mtro. Ricardo y al equipo Platzi.

sin problema

Version 6

Valla Valla muy interesante !

Normalmente utilizo 4.5, pero es momento de actualizar!!

Muy recomendable si son nuevos en este curso como yo, seguir la guia y dejar la version 2019 con el .NET core 3.1
Asi no van a ver diferencias entre las proximas clases y nuestros proyectos en caso de que no entendamos algun punto

Esta mal el titulo de este post, no confundir .net framework con .net core y .net. Como bien comentan los compañeros las diferencias, el objetivo que quisieron transmitir en este post es conocer .net 6 (no .net framework).

using System; namespace helloWordPlatzi { class Program { static void Main(string\[] args) { Console.WriteLine( "Hello World!" ); } } }
Visual Studio 2022 para mac no soporta la versión de Net Core 3.1 por lo que para poder trabajar con la versión del curso, toca irse al older download y descargar una versión inferior...

en lo personal me gusta la versión 2019 para comprender de mejor manera la razón de cada una de las estructuras que se crean en automático en la versión 2022.

.NET es una plataforma de desarrollo gratuita, multiplataforma (Mac, Linux y Windows) y de código abierto para crear muchos tipos de aplicaciones (para escritorio, móviles, web, cloud, videojuegos, Internet de las cosas e inteligencia artificial).

.NET Framework es es la primera versión del actual .NET lanzada en 2002 , solo funcionaba para Windows , las aplicaciones creadas con .NET Framework no podían ser llevadas a otras plataformas y llego solo hasta la versión 4.8

.NET Core es el sucesor de .NET Framework lanzada en 2016, funcionaba para más sistemas operativos y no solo para Windows y llego hasta la versión 3.1

.NET es la sucesora de .NET Core lanzada en noviembre de 2020 y actualmente , noviembre de 2022, esta en su versión 7.0

HISTORIAL DE VERSIONES

Recomiendo que chequeen este gran video para entender bien el ecosistema .net